Interpretation

The line frames respect as reciprocal rather than unconditional: if someone approaches you with contempt, they should not expect deference in return. It implies a boundary-setting ethic—self-respect requires refusing to reward disrespectful behavior—and it also hints at a social contract in which civility is maintained through mutual recognition. The phrasing (“you’re not gonna”) gives it the tone of a blunt, spoken admonition, suggesting it was likely delivered in a confrontational or corrective moment (e.g., responding to criticism, heckling, or an interpersonal slight). As a maxim, it endorses dignity and assertiveness, though it can also be read as transactional, making respect contingent on others’ conduct.
